1. Perform the Best Stretches

There are several ways to get immediate pain relief for sciatica. One of the best ways is to perform specific stretches and exercises designed for the sciatic nerve. Examples of these can include hamstring, piriformis, and sciatic nerve glide stretches.

These types of stretches can:

  • Lengthen and relax the sciatic muscles
  • Increase circulation
  • Helps alleviate nerve pain

Additionally, regular physical activity can also be beneficial in relieving this pain. Low-impact activities such as walking, swimming, and cycling can help to strengthen the muscles and improve overall flexibility.

2. Applying the Proper Heat Treatment

Heat therapy helps to increase circulation, relax the muscles, and reduce the pain associated with sciatica. It can be administered in various ways such as:

  • The use of hot packs
  • Warm baths or showers
  • Heating pads
  • Infrared heat lamps

The type of heat treatment should be based on a person’s individual needs and comfort level. With this, it is important to make sure the temperature is not too high, and the area is monitored to make sure that the heat is being applied safely and effectively.

4. Consulting With a Chiropractor for Long-Term Solutions

Chiropractic care is specifically designed to treat nerve-related pain and discomfort. They can use spinal manipulations and other techniques to help relieve back pain, as well as identify any underlying conditions that may be causing it.

They can also provide helpful advice on lifestyle changes that can reduce flare-ups, such as exercise and proper posture. Ultimately, they can help strengthen the muscles in your back and legs, which can prevent sciatic nerve pain from occurring in the first place.
